Porto is the second largest city in Portugal and is one of the major urban areas in Southwestern Europe. The city of Porto has a population of around 240,000 people, with the urban area having 1,475,000 people and the metro area has around 1,763,000. The University of Porto is a public university that was founded in 1911. It is the second largest university in Portugal and has around 30,700 students enrolled and a further 800 students studying 742 post doc studies. The University of Porto offers courses in areas such as Architecture, Medicine, Economics, Engineering, Fine Arts, Law, Letters, Medicine, Nutrition and Sciences.
